The Biological Basis of Entrepreneurship
Abstract: Taking up a profession is the most imperative perspective in an individual's life. This to a great extent relies on upon individual effectiveness and resemblance of any work and in particular what one needs to turn into. Here comes the role of genetics and in this review we highlight the importance of genetic factors that lead to making a person a entrepreneur.
